Pros

Generous PTO, Work from Home, Company Car, Company Phone, 401K w decent match, medical, dental.

Cons

WEX is a house of cards. A rudderless ship with little leadership, accountability or effective communication. WEX has been blowing smoke up everyone's you know what to their employees, customers and stockholders for years. The management there, by in large, is constantly talking out of both sides of their mouths, from the top down. They tout that they will always promote internally, but more often than not, they hire external candidates. Many of the middle managers, and the directors, never did the actual job of the people that they are managing. Some managers have never even been in the industry before they got the job. All of this creates a major disconnect. You'll get lip service that there are resources to help you advance your career, but again, those are just words, with no action. Nobody will take an active role in helping your career path; not your manager, nor anyone else internally. Why do you think you see very little people actually retire from WEX? They just get fed up and move on, finding a better job some place else. From outsourcing customer service, to constantly making directionless reorganizational changes, to hopping from project to project without any real plan or execution, to poor internal and external “double talk” communication, its been a downward spiral for years. The customers have had enough, and the employees have stopped caring. Confident in the company and its leadership has dwindled drastically, and both customers & their employees are leaving in droves. The stock price drop is a direct result of all of this.
